Executive Communications, Speechwriter

Job Overview:

RWJBH is seeking an exceptional and strategic Communications writer to support the office of the CEO. Working alongside the Chief of Staff to the CEO this individual will craft compelling, high-impact speeches, talking points, op-eds, presentations, and both internal and external communications that align with the CEO's voice, the organization's mission, and its strategic priorities. The individual will also help craft standard language, messaging, and talking points for key leaders throughout the system. The candidate will help develop and standardize language used by key leaders as they prepare for speeches and events. The ideal candidate will be a versatile and diplomatic communicator, deeply attuned to the healthcare landscape, with the ability to translate complex topics into clear, persuasive messages for diverse audiences.

Reports to:

  • The Executive Communications, Speechwriter reports directly to the Senior Vice President, External Communications with a matrixed reporting relationship to the office of the President & CEO

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in communications, English, Journalism, Political Science, Public Health, or related field; Master's degree preferred.
  • 5+ years of professional writing or speechwriting experience, preferably in healthcare, public policy, corporate communications, or government.
  • Demonstrated ability to write in the voice of a senior executive or public official.
  • Exceptional storytelling, research, editing, and interpersonal skills.
  • Deep understanding of healthcare industry trends, terminology, and policy issues.
  • Ability to manage sensitive information with discretion and navigate complex organizational dynamics.
  • Deadline-driven, flexible, and able to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.

Essential Functions:

  • Speechwriting & Messaging
    • Research, draft, and edit speeches, remarks, scripts, and talking points for the CEO for a variety of engagements (conferences, media appearances, town halls, board meetings, etc.).
    • Tailor messaging to fit audience, tone, and strategic objectives, maintaining consistency with the CEO's voice and the organization's mission and values.
  • Strategic Content Development
    • Collaborate closely with the communications team, executive leadership, and subject matter experts to develop content that supports key organizational initiatives.
    • Write op-eds, bylines, and forewords for industry publications and high-profile platforms on behalf of the CEO.
  • Stakeholder Engagement
    • Support executive visibility by preparing compelling narratives that engage internal stakeholders (staff, clinicians) and external audiences (policy leaders, media, partners, community).
    • Anticipate communication needs related to health policy, regulatory developments, organizational transformation, and crisis response.
  • Media & Presentation Preparation
    • Help craft and implement a strategy to maximize messaging opportunities for the CEO
    • Prepare briefing materials and messaging guides for interviews, public forums, and media engagements.
    • Support development of multimedia presentations and visual storytelling to enhance executive presence.
  • Communications Team Alignment
    • Work closely with external and internal communications team to cascade CEO message to leadership throughout organization
    • Support system-wide leadership communications efforts through aligned message development and curated communications process.
